During the year, UV index levels fluctuate significantly, indicating varying risks for skin damage from sun exposure. The low-risk months are January, December (UV Index 2), and November, February, October (UV Index 3), where exposure is generally safe with longer burn times of 30-45 minutes. As the season progresses into March and April (UV Index 5-6), caution is advised as burn times decrease to 25-30 minutes. The high-risk months, notably May through August (UV Index 8-9), present very high UV exposure, with burn times shortening dramatically to just 15 minutes. In September, risk lowers slightly (UV Index 6) but remains significant with a burn time of 25 minutes. Visitors and residents are strongly encouraged to protect their skin, especially during peak UV months, by wearing sunscreen, protective clothing, and seeking shade whenever possible to minimize potential harm.
